Recreation Hall National Register of Historic Places Inventory Nomination Form text: Built in 1948. Replaced old recreation hall which burned in 1945. Large two-story frame building. Presently the offices of the City of Saint Paul (Faulkner 1986).
Supplemental information provided by NOAA: Recreation Hall (City Office and Public Safety Building)—built in 1947–1948 (Alaska Fishery and Fur-Seal Industries 1950, 55; Alaska Fishery and Fur-Seal Industries 1952, 47). |
